Home
last modified time | relevance | path

Searched refs:ASSSplitContext (Results 1 - 6 of 6) sorted by relevance

/third_party/ffmpeg/libavcodec/
H A Dass_split.h101 typedef struct ASSSplitContext ASSSplitContext; typedef
110 ASSSplitContext *ff_ass_split(const char *buf);
124 ASSDialog *ff_ass_split_dialog(ASSSplitContext *ctx, const char *buf);
127 * Free all the memory allocated for an ASSSplitContext.
131 void ff_ass_split_free(ASSSplitContext *ctx);
189 ASSStyle *ff_ass_style_get(ASSSplitContext *ctx, const char *style);
H A Dass_split.c205 struct ASSSplitContext { struct
213 static uint8_t *realloc_section_array(ASSSplitContext *ctx) in realloc_section_array()
255 static const char *ass_split_section(ASSSplitContext *ctx, const char *buf) in ass_split_section()
357 static int ass_split(ASSSplitContext *ctx, const char *buf) in ass_split()
382 ASSSplitContext *ff_ass_split(const char *buf) in ff_ass_split()
384 ASSSplitContext *ctx = av_mallocz(sizeof(*ctx)); in ff_ass_split()
397 static void free_section(ASSSplitContext *ctx, const ASSSection *section) in free_section()
433 ASSDialog *ff_ass_split_dialog(ASSSplitContext *ctx, const char *buf) in ff_ass_split_dialog()
470 void ff_ass_split_free(ASSSplitContext *ctx) in ff_ass_split_free()
578 ASSStyle *ff_ass_style_get(ASSSplitContext *ct
[all...]
H A Dwebvttenc.c34 ASSSplitContext *ass_ctx;
H A Dsrtenc.c37 ASSSplitContext *ass_ctx;
H A Dttmlenc.c41 ASSSplitContext *ass_ctx;
H A Dmovtextenc.c75 ASSSplitContext *ass_ctx;

Completed in 6 milliseconds